Press REP1 during CD play.

The’’REPEAT” indicator lights upandthecurrently selected track is played repeatedly.

Press REP1 again to cancel Repeat play.

Note

If Repeat play is not activated, all the tracks on the disc are played repeatedly.

Press INT during CD play.

The “SCAN indicator lights up and the first 10 seconds of all the tracks on the disc are played in order.

When the desired track is found, press INT again. The unit returns to the normal CD play.

Press RANDOM during CD play.

The “RANDOM indicator lights up and the tracks on the disc are played randomly.

Press RANDOM again to cancel Random play.

Notes

Smaller 3-inch (8 cm) CDs cannot be played on this unit. Anddonot useanadaptor as it may cause malfunctioning.

When you inserla disc, CD play starts at the first track on the disc. When switching back from Radio mode, etc. if you press CD with a disc inserted, CD play starts at the point on the disc where it had stopped previously.

During Random play, even if ~ is pressed repeatedly, the track currently in play is restarted.
